    Yes, you can only sign a free agent with anything more than minimum is only if you are under salary cap. Even then, you can only sign that player for the amount of money one has below salary cap. E.g. if Lakers has 50 mil in cap room, and salary cap is 56 mil, Lakers can only offer Marion 6 million a year. With bird rights, a team can RESIGN its own players even when over salary cap.

    Let's assume that for next season there were no salary cap rules and you could drop and sign whoever you wanted to. If that were the case, I would still not go after Shaun Marion. Have you forgotten why he was traded? He was traded because he was no longer the focal point of the offense. The attention turned from him and went to Amare. He got hurt/offended and demanded a trade. It's funny that there were all these trade rumors of Marion for AK47, since they are in essentially the same situation.

    I don't want that ego on our team. He was the second scoring option on the Suns behind Amare. If he came to the Lake Show he'd be at least third behind Kobe, Pau and Bynum. Just because a guy is a great player, does not mean that you just throw him on the team, no matter how sick the lineup looks.
